Technical specifications and design features
Engine. vortex 30 It is a medium-speed water-cooled two-stroke engine, which is a rare three-cylinder unit for engines of this power and provides a decent uniformity of rotation of the shaft. The nominal power is 30 horsepower, but the actual performance on the propeller often depends on the quality of the carburetor configuration and the state of the exhaust system.
An important feature is the presence of reverse-reducerUnlike many modern analogues, it uses a mechanical switching system that requires periodic lubrication and adjustment of thrusts. The ignition system can be either contact (magdino) or electronic (FSE), the latter greatly simplifies the start and stability of work at high revs.
Differences in modifications vortex 30 and 30 Electron
The Electron was equipped with an electronic ignition system for the ELS, which made it much easier to launch, especially in cold weather. The basic version with the Magdino required a more energetic starter jerk and regular cleaning of the interrupter contacts.
The engine weighs about 46 kilograms in running order, a critical parameter for many users when transporting. Despite its massive nature, the transom mounting design allows the engine to be installed on boats of various types, from classic "kazak" to modern PVC boats. Cooling system off-shore water works effectively, but is extremely sensitive to the ingress of sand and silt into the water intake.
The main design feature of the vortex 30 is a three-cylinder block that provides high traction at low revs, but creates an increased level of vibration compared to four-strokes.
Analysis of engine reliability and resource
The issue of reliability is the most controversial in the discussion vortex 30On the one hand, the simplicity of the design allows you to eliminate most of the malfunctions in the field with a minimum set of tools. On the other hand, the quality of materials and assembly in different years of production differed significantly. Many owners note that with proper care, the engine can work hundreds of hours without opening the crank mechanism.
But there are also vulnerabilities. squirrel They often cause air suction, which leads to poorer mix and overheating of pistons. Also, the weak spots include the lower unit pipe, which, if operated carelessly, is prone to deformation. Failure statistics show that most problems arise from the failure of the mixture proportions or the use of poor-quality oil.

β οΈ Warning: When operating in salt water, be sure to use corrosion-resistant lubricant on all external surfaces and regularly flush the cooling system with fresh water, otherwise corrosion will destroy the cylinder block in one season.
The engine's life is directly dependent on operating mode, and full-gas operation reduces the life of bearings and rod fingers, and 80 percent of maximum power is considered optimal, balancing speed and durability. Lubrication system Spraying requires a precise dosage of oil in gasoline, usually in a ratio of 1:25 or 1:30 depending on the recommendation of the oil manufacturer.
Fuel consumption and economy
Economics is not the strongest side Whirlwind 30The average fuel consumption at full gas is about 10-12 liters per hour, which at current prices for fuel becomes a significant expense. At cruising speeds, which are usually about 30-35 km / h, the flow rate is reduced to 6-8 liters, which is more acceptable for long transitions.
It's important to understand that the actual flow rate is very much dependent on the load on the boat and the condition of the propeller. Incorrectly chosen propeller pitch can increase fuel consumption by 15-20%. carburetor The K-33, installed on most models, is prone to unstable operation with sudden changes in the position of the throttle, which also affects the combustion efficiency of the mixture.
For comparison of efficiency, the data in the table, which presents the averaged flow rates for different operating modes, can be considered:
| Mode of work | Turnover (rpm) | Speed (km/h) | Expenditure (L/h) |
|---|---|---|---|
| Idle move | 1000 | 0 | 1.5 - 2.0 |
| Troiling | 2000 | 8-10 | 3.5 - 4.5 |
| Cruiser | 3500 | 32-35 | 6.0 - 8.0 |
| Full gas. | 5000 | 42-45 | 10.0 - 12.0 |
Reduce the cost by proper running and timely cleaning carburetorThe presence of soot on candles and in the exhaust windows indicates a rich mixture, which leads to over-fuel consumption and lower power, and the adjustment of the quality of the mixture at idling and maximum speeds should be carried out only after the engine has warmed up to operating temperature.
Typical malfunctions and methods of their elimination
Operation vortex 30 It's not without the periodic technical problems that every owner needs to know, and one of the most common problems is overheating caused by clogging of the cooling system or the impeller collapse. Water pump It is made of rubber and plastic, so its life is limited, and replacement is required every 2-3 seasons of active use.
Ignition problems are also common, especially on magdinos. Contact oxidation, high-voltage wires or capacitors can cause engine inability to start or triple. Electronic versions are easier for owners, but there may be damage to the switch or sensors. Diagnostics often require multimeter and a candle key.

β οΈ If the engine suddenly stalled and does not start, in any case do not continue to turn the starter "to the victory" - this can fill the candles and discharge the battery, making further start difficult.
Leaks from the gearbox are another common complaint, usually involving wear and tear of the glands or damage to the gearbox body from impacts on underwater obstacles. Getting water into the gearbox leads to emulsifying the lubricant and rapidly destroying the gears. Regular visual inspection of the lower unit and replacing the lubricant in the gearbox before each season will help avoid costly repairs.
Owner impressions: noise, vibration and comfort
When it comes to comfort, vortex 30 It's a very, very low-powered four-stroke engine, and the two-stroke engine is very noisy, and at full throttle, it's almost impossible to talk in a boat without raising your voice. Noise level reaches values at which a long stay next to a working motor without earplugs can cause discomfort.
Vibration was the second factor affecting fatigue. Despite the three-cylinder scheme, the Soviet engine balance left much to be desired. Vibration is transmitted to the boat's transom and can lead to loosening of the mounting bolts. Owners often use additional vibratory gaskets or reinforce the transom design to reduce resonance fluctuations.

Cost of maintenance and availability of spare parts
One of the main arguments for the purchase vortex 30 And unlike imported engines, where custom parts can take months, parts for the vortex can be found in almost any boating store or market. Repairability It is provided with a wide range of parts: from piston rings to entire cylinder blocks.
The maintenance costs are also at an acceptable level, and major repairs, which include the replacement of all the glands, bearings and piston group, will cost many times less than the same procedure for a foreign engine. vortex 30 It is an attractive option for regions with limited budgets or for those who prefer to repair equipment on their own.
When buying used vortex 30 immediately budget replacement of all ossels and lower unit tube - this is a standard procedure that will prolong the life of the engine for several seasons.
However, it is worth considering that the price of new parts has been increasing recently, and the quality of some products may vary, and it is recommended to purchase parts only from trusted suppliers or the original manufacturer, avoiding cheap analogues of unknown origin, which can fail after a few hours of operation.

β οΈ Warning: Buying a vortex of 30 b/y, be sure to check the compression in all cylinders - it should be at least 9 atmospheres and differ by no more than 1 atmosphere between the cylinders, otherwise the engine will require immediate repair.

What is the maximum speed of a boat with a 30 vortex engine?
Speed depends on the type of boat and its loading. On a light aluminum boat (for example, Kazanka-M), you can reach speeds up to 40-45 km / h. On heavier PVC boats, the speed is usually 30-35 km / h.
Which oil is best used for the mixture?
It is recommended to use special two-stroke oils labeled TC-W3. It is allowed to use M-12TP oils or imported analogues from Motul, Shell. The mixing ratio is usually 1:25 (40 ml per 1 liter of gasoline) for running and 1:30-1:40 for operation.
Why does vortex 30 stall at high revs?
Most often, this indicates a violation of the fuel supply (jeeler clogged, hose clamped) or a violation of spark formation (coil failure, switch malfunction), also the cause may be air sucking through the crankshaft coils.
Can I put a vortex 30 on an inflatable boat?
Yes, you can if the boat has a rigid transom that can withstand the weight of the engine (46 kg) and the thrust it creates, but because of the weight of the engine and the high center of gravity, it requires caution, especially when driving on the wave.
